Analysis of Influencing Factors on Changes in Total Phosphorus Concentration in Datong Lake
Datong lake is an inner lake formed by the dismemberment of embankments in Dongting lake,it is a natural barrier to maintain the ecological security of south Dongting lake,but the problem of excessive total phosphorus is prominent.The data is collected on water quality,hydrology,meteorology,and external pollutant inputs in the Datong lake basin in recent years,and the correlation between different water environmental impact factors is analyzed,and the effects of seasonal changes,external pollutant inputs,and water level changes on the total phosphorus concentration are clarified in the water body.The results indicate that the total phosphorus concentration in Datong lake is influenced by factors such as water temperature,water level,turbidity,algal blooms,and the discharge of aquaculture wastewater.In order to promote the stable and positive development of water quality in Datong lake and protect the ecological environment of the lake area,it is necessary to strengthen the treatment of agricultural non-point source pollution such as tail water from surrounding planting and breeding,reduce pollutants entering the lake,strengthen water system connectivity,enhance the fluidity of rivers and lakes,purify endogenous pollutants,and form an adjustable,controllable,and interconnected water network system.
